Skip to content

Flake check for 12/merge by hadockzin[bot] #23

Flake check for 12/merge by hadockzin[bot]

Flake check for 12/merge by hadockzin[bot] #23

Workflow file for this run

name: Flake check
run-name: Flake check for ${{ github.ref_name }} by ${{ github.actor }}
on:
pull_request:
push:
branches:
- main
workflow_dispatch:
jobs:
check:
timeout-minutes: 32
name: Check flake on ${{ matrix.system }}
runs-on: ${{ matrix.runner }}
permissions:
contents: read
strategy:
matrix:
include:
- system: x86_64-linux
runner: ubuntu-latest
- system: aarch64-linux
runner: ubuntu-24.04-arm
steps:
- name: Checkout repository
uses: actions/checkout@de0fac2e4500dabe0009e67214ff5f5447ce83dd # v6.0.2
with:
persist-credentials: false
- name: Set up Nix
uses: cachix/install-nix-action@4e002c8ec80594ecd40e759629461e26c8abed15 # v31.9.0
- name: Set up Cachix
uses: cachix/cachix-action@3ba601ff5bbb07c7220846facfa2cd81eeee15a1 # v16
with:
name: heitor
authToken: ${{ secrets.CACHIX_AUTH_TOKEN }}
- name: Run flake check
run: nix flake check --accept-flake-config